Deluxe Homemade Muesli
Awaken your senses and fuel your day with our deluxe homemade muesli. This hearty breakfast staple, originating from Switzerland in the early 20th century, offers a symphony of textures and flavors, marrying the creaminess of oats with the crunch of nuts, the sweetness of honey, and the tang of dried fruits. Each spoonful is not just a delicious bite, but a wholesome and nourishing start to your day.
Ingredients
- 2 cups Rolled oats
- 1 cup Mixed nuts (almonds, walnuts, hazelnuts), roughly chopped
- 1/2 cup Mixed seeds (pumpkin, sunflower, flax)
- 1 cup Dried fruit (raisins, apricots, cranberries), roughly chopped
- 3 tablespoons Honey
- 1 teaspoon Ground cinnamon

Instructions
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the rolled oats, chopped nuts, mixed seeds, and dried fruit.
- Drizzle the honey over the mixture, then sprinkle the ground cinnamon on top.
- Using a large spoon, stir the mixture until well combined. Make sure the honey and cinnamon are evenly distributed throughout the muesli.
- Transfer the muesli into an airtight container for storage. It will keep well at room temperature for up to 2 weeks.
- When ready to serve, scoop 1/2 cup of the muesli into a bowl. Top with your choice of milk or yogurt, and enjoy a nutritious and satisfying breakfast.
